As a Medical Intensive Care Registered Nurse
, you will have the opportunity to care for patients with a wide variety of conditions. You will have the ability to learn advanced skills that include: EVD therapy, Advanced Stroke Care, Roto‑Prone therapy and Continuous Renal Replacement therapy, among many others. Our dedicated Registered Nurses are actively involved in department shared leadership and facility wide committees. Our Registered Nurses also have the opportunity to participate and receive support for completion of the Critical Care certification.

Located on an 80‑acre campus in Mesa, Arizona, Banner Desert Medical Center is one of Arizona's largest and most comprehensive hospitals and was recognized by U.S. News and World Report as one of Phoenix's Best Hospitals. We provide an abundance of exceptional opportunities with more than 700 licensed beds, including over 100 dedicated to children and 76 dedicated to our NICU.
Areas of excellence include high‑risk pregnancy and neonatal care, obstetrics and gynecology, pediatrics, cardiology, oncology and emergency medicine. With 33 operating rooms, we offer a full range of surgical specialties and advanced technology that includes the da Vinci Surgical System.
This position assesses, plans, implements, evaluates and documents nursing care of patients in accordance with organizational policies and in accordance with standards of professional nursing practice utilizing the framework for professional nursing practice and development. This position is accountable for the quality of nursing services delivered by self or others who are under their direction. This position utilizes specialized knowledge, judgment, and nursing skills necessary to assess data and plan, provide and evaluate care appropriate to the physical and developmental age of assigned patients.
